What is LinkedIn Anyway?

• Launched in 2003• Online resume and portfolio• Virtual professional networking 24/7• 147 million user as of January 2012• 45% growth since last year at this time• North America/Europe: 66% of users• Females: 42% of users• Intended to be gated access• Find leads, build network & increase credibility

LinkedIn Etiquette• Think of this as a professional networking event

– 24/7, 365 days a year– Conduct yourself accordingly

• Select your profile picture with care– Make it as professional as possible

• Language– Use your best, pretend your mother is watching you!

• Always customize a Connection request– Shows respect for the other person– Conveys the importance with which you view professional

relationships & introductions• Not the venue for personal status updates

– Keep those on your personal Facebook timeline

LinkedIn Best Practices

• COMPLETE your profile and keep it UPDATED• CHECK OFTEN for invitations and messages• READ REGULARLY – your streams keep you in the loop• SEARCH OFTEN for new Connections… and past ones!• PARTICIPATE in group discussions and Q&A• DON’T BE SHY about asking for clarification when you get

an invitation from someone you don’t recognize• DECIDE if you will take on the LION mindset or be more

selective about your Connections• USE APPLICATIONS to enhance your use of LinkedIn
